Why You Could Make Good Savings With Digital Canvas Prints

10 September 2010

Many people know that buying in wholesale will allow them to get big discounts off the retail price. In case of printing, one way to get low-priced canvas prints is to go for offset printing.

The common rule for getting lower prices in offset printing is to place an order of 500 copies or more. You will enjoy deals because the price of each copy will drop if you request sizeable orders.

Similarly, if you will double your order, the price cut will also be twice over. Ultimately, after subtracting the massive discounts, what’s left is all that you have to pay for.

On the whole, offset printing is one good way to save especially if you always require thousands of prints. However in case you want at least 10 replicates or even just 1 replicate, the offset printing is not a practical preference because the small number of order will only contribute to the price to go up rather than go down. In this circumstance, your best option then is to look for other deals that accept small number of prints at low prices.

How to get cheap deals for canvas printing

Offset canvas printing involves a more complex method compared to digital canvas prints. It is because, printing using the offset process normally will involve going through different stages including filmmaking, color separation, and printing.

Moreover, the printing itself requires a few rounds of image transfers before finally arriving at the final stage of printing. In contrast, digital printing is done in a less complicated manner and so the whole operation will only take a little while to finish. And because the digital method do not require many things, the cost of digital canvas prints is cheaper.

Likewise, since there are stages in the offset printing that are not needed in digital canvas printing, the turnaround time for all your orders will be faster. For one, the stages required for the full process of printing is very few. The printing is somewhat direct and this makes the production to progress at a faster rate.

You would even find many digital printing manufacturers that can deliver your canvas prints within just 24 hours after the placement of your order. After that, depending on your preferences, either you can pick your prints or the company will send it to your home.

Moreover, since the printing of digital canvas prints is really rapid, you may save hundreds of dollars as you don’t have to request rush orders any longer. This is another benefit of choosing digital over offset.
Furthermore, it is apparent that not many materials will be used up when the processing time for printing is shorter. And if there is less materials, then the price of the canvas prints will be less too.

As you can see, offset printing can be cheap but only with large volume orders. Additionally, with offset, you mostly pay for the set up cost while in digital canvas prints most of the money that you pay is for the ink and paper.
